Representations of Direct Product of Matrix Algebras

Suppose B is the unital algebra consisting of the algebraic product of full matrix algebras over an index set X. A bijection is set up between the equivalence classes of irreducible representations of B as operators on a Banach space and the sigma-complete ultrafilters on X, Theorem 1. Therefore, if X has less than measurable cardinality (e.g. accessible), the equivalence classes of the irreducible representations of B are labeled by points of X, and all representations of B are described, Theorem 3.
